In just a few hours, the 2025 Men’s Royal Rumble Match is set to take place, and the WWE Universe is buzzing with excitement. Roman Reigns, CM Punk, and more are already confirmed as entrants, and there are strong hints suggesting that The Rock could make a shocking return.
However, after this week’s SmackDown, it seems likely that OG Bloodline member, Jimmy Uso, could be eliminated by Shinsuke Nakamura to set up a feud for WrestleMania 41. This speculation arose after the latest episode of the blue brand, where the King of Strong Style was spotted in the background as Big Jim made his entrance.
This subtle hint suggests that WWE might be planning a feud between these two stars. With Nakamura currently holding the United States Championship, it’s possible that the mid-card title could be on the line in this potential rivalry.
If both Shinsuke and Jimmy enter the over-the-top-rope contest, the Japanese star could be the one to eliminate the Samoan Twin, planting the initial seeds for their upcoming title feud. The former Tag Team Champion could then seek revenge for his elimination, fueling their rivalry.
Additionally, WWE could incorporate a storyline that highlights the contrast between Jey and Jimmy’s singles runs. It could be done by showcasing how the YEET Master is receiving world title opportunities while his brother is struggling to break through.
This angle has already been referenced, with Carmelo Hayes mocking Jimmy and taking personal shots at his lack of opportunities. Nakamura could follow a similar path, intensifying their rivalry and positioning Jimmy as a serious contender for the U.S. Title.
A feud for the mid-card championship would be a great way for WWE to establish Jimmy’s singles run outside the Bloodline saga. Ultimately, it will be interesting to see what unfolds at Royal Rumble 2025 when the 30-man over-the-top-rope battle takes place.

Anamaria Baralt says she is often asked what her cousins Lyle and Erik Menendez are like.
“Lyle’s humor is sharp and quick, it’s one of the things that’s kept him and our family going,” says Baralt as she talks about the brothers, who fatally shot their parents Jose and Kitty Menendez at their Beverly Hills, Calif. home in 1989. “And Erik, he’s got this deep compassion that makes him someone everyone can lean on. But what stands out most about them is their resilience.”
While serving life sentences in prison, Erik, 54, and Lyle, 57 — who claim they killed their parents because they feared for their lives after years of sexual abuse by Jose — have “managed to build meaningful lives,” says Baralt, 53, who spoke about the brothers’ much-anticipated resentencing hearing at a National Press Club event in Washington, D.C., on Jan. 23.
“What’s driving me, and my family, is love,” she tells PEOPLE. “Their continued incarceration serves no societal purpose and only prolongs our family’s pain. They’ve taken responsibility for their actions, they’ve committed their lives to helping others and they’ve done it all while carrying the weight of their past and the judgment of the world. All we want is to welcome them home.”
Erik and Lyle Menendez.
California Dept. of Corrections via AP

In October 2024, the Menendez brothers appeared to be on the verge of release when then-L.A. District Attorney George Gascón filed a re-sentencing request that could have ultimately freed them. However, Gascón lost his bid for reelection, and what newly elected district attorney Nathan Hochman plans to do is unclear.
Los Angeles County District Attorney Nathan Hochman.
Damian Dovargane/AP
“We are still figuring it out,” Hochman told PEOPLE when asked if he would support or withdraw his predecessor’s resentencing motion.
The brothers’ journey to what they — and nearly two-dozen supportive family members like Baralt — hope will pave the way to their release has been a long time coming. Their fate took an unexpected twist last year when a new generation of supporters joined the call for their release from prison, owing to a cultural shift in understanding of the devastating toll that sexual abuse survivors face, along with the impact of Netflix’s hit drama Monsters: The Lyle and Erik Menendez Story and a documentary on the streaming service, The Menendez Brothers.
Anamaria Baralt, niece of Jose Menendez.
Mike Blake/Reuters
Want to keep up with the latest crime coverage? Click here to get breaking crime news, ongoing trial coverage and details of intriguing unsolved cases in the True Crime Newsletter.
By last October, efforts to re-sentence the men to 50 years to life — making them immediately eligible for parole as “youthful offenders” since Lyle was 21 and Erik was 18 at the time of the murders—seemed to be on the threshold of success. But many now wonder if their best shot at walking free is fading due to the November election of Hochman, who ordered a re-examination of the case and replaced members of the D.A.’s re-sentencing unit with attorneys of his own picking.
At this point,” says Laurie Levenson, a professor at L.A.’s Loyola Law School who has followed the case for decades, “Hochman is reviewing the case because he’s not quite sure that he feels the same way about it as Gascón.”
Asked if Gascón losing the election was a setback for the brothers, Cliff Gardner, one of the attorneys representing the Menendez brothers, tells PEOPLE that it “remains to be seen.”
Lyle, Erik, Kitty and Jose Menendez.
“In the typical homicide case, of course, a more conservative prosecutor would want to pay great attention to views expressed by family members of the deceased,” he says. “Here, it is very much an open question if the new district attorney will seriously consider the many, many family members of both Kitty and Jose Menendez who have come forward repeatedly to plead for Erik and Lyle’s release after 35 years in prison.”
Even by big-city standards, the grisly shotgun murders of former beauty queen Kitty, 47, and wealthy music executive Jose, 45, as the couple watched TV in their Beverly Hills home in August of 1989 was a shocking crime. Arrested seven months later, Erik and Lyle were charged with murder and tried together before separate juries, with both trials ending in mistrial. In a second trial in 1996, the brothers were found guilty and sentenced to life without parole.
The 1989 crime scene.
Los Angeles County District Attorney’s Office
“This tragedy will always be the most astounding and regrettable thing that has ever happened in my life,” Lyle told PEOPLE in 2017. “You can’t escape the memories, and I long ago stopped trying.”
For much of the past three and a half decades, the Menendezes — who have both been active in organizing support for their fellow inmates — filed appeals but knew the odds of being released were slim. In 2023, however, their attorneys, riding a groundswell of public support, filed a habeas corpus petition asking for a review of newly discovered evidence, including a letter Erik purportedly sent to a cousin months before the killings that mentioned Jose’s ongoing sexual assault, and an affidavit by a member of the boy band Menudo who alleged that Jose, who headed the band’s record label, raped him in the 1980s. The habeas petition remains a possible avenue for freedom.
But Levenson isn’t convinced that this new evidence would be enough to overturn the Menendezes’s 1996 convictions. “I don’t think that’s likely to succeed,” she says.
And now, exactly what will happen at the resentencing hearing beginning on March 20 is anyone’s guess.
The brothers, according to their cousin, are trying their best to take things day by day. “Erik and Lyle are cautiously optimistic,” says Baralt. “They’re grateful for the support they’ve received and for the opportunity to have their sentence reconsidered.”

Adams County sheriff, current and former deputies, win $5 million judgment for wrongful termination by predecessor
A federal jury found former Adams County Sheriff Rick Reigenborn was political and punitive and violated the First Amendment when he fired four top commanders after winning the 2018 sheriff’s election because they supported his opponent. The jury awarded the men $5 million on Tuesday.
In the highly unusual case, current Adams County Sheriff Gene Claps and three other former top commanders who were working at the office in 2018 sued their own county commissioners for the wrongful terminations six years ago – even though they have all landed good jobs, or, in one case, even retired by now.
In 2018, all of the men were supporting the incumbent sheriff Mike McIntosh, a Republican, for re-election. They donated to his campaign and showed up at campaign events.
But Reigenborn, a Democrat, and a one-time department sergeant with no top command experience, surprisingly won the 2018 election in a political swing year. On Reigenborn’s first day in office, he summarily fired Claps and a handful of others for no reason other than their past political support, the jury found.
Their lawyers spent nine days in a federal courtroom playing tapes, showing text messages and other documents to jurors proving Reigenborn’s intentions to get revenge on his political enemies when he was sworn in as sheriff. Reigenborn had lost the 2014 election to McIntosh and left the department.
“He nursed a paranoid grudge for four years against Mr. McIntosh’s most prominent supporters,” said Iris Halpern, the attorney for the plaintiffs, from the firm Rathod Mohamedbhai. “When he won in 2018, Mr. Reigenborn wasted no time carrying out his personal vendetta, purging the command staff and cleaning house of McIntosh supporters.”
The county’s attorneys countered in closing arguments that Reigenborn had the right to hire his own executive team, but that argument proved unconvincing to the jury.
“The only thing that matters is whether his decision to terminate the employment of these four men violated the First Amendment of the United States Constitution. That’s it. That’s the only question. And it didn’t,” argued Katherine M.L. Pratt, with Thompson Coe, a private firm that represented the county. “This wasn’t about plaintiff’s political support for Mr. McIntosh. It was about how they treated their coworkers at the Adams County Sheriff’s Office.”
The verdict is likely to resonate across Colorado, where the results of sheriff elections can carry political implications for deputies who are often drawn into campaigns whether they like it or not.
A CPR News investigation in 2022 found that Reigenborn abruptly locked top command staff out of the headquarters building after he was sworn in. After firing the top command staff, Reigenborn replaced them with officers from small departments around Colorado.

Acclaimed filmmaker Quentin Tarantino has condemned the current state of the film industry. The Pulp Fiction director rose to Hollywood stardom with his stunning debut Reservoir Dogs in 1993 and has gone on to enjoy a critically and commercially successful career across nine feature films. The 61-year-old has long stated that his 10th movie will be the last of his career, but some of his recent comments suggest audiences could be waiting a while before he decides to make it.
While at the Sundance Film Festival (via Variety), Tarantino revealed his next project was to be a play, not a movie, before launching a scathing attack on the state of the movie industry currently, as well as the fact that theatrical releases are not the focal point anymore. He goes on to call the whole process a “…show pony exercise,” before reiterating the importance of theaters for helping to keep the movie industry ticking over. Check out Tarantino’s full comments on the matter below:
“That’s a big f*cking deal pulling [a play] off, and I don’t know if I can. So here we go. That’s a challenge, a genuine challenge, but making movies? Well, what the f*ck is a movie now? What — something that plays in theaters for a token release for four f*cking weeks? All right, and by the second week you can watch it on television. I didn’t get into all this for diminishing returns.
I mean, it was bad enough in ’97. It was bad enough in 2019, and that was the last f*cking year of movies. That was a sh*t deal, as far as I was concerned, the fact that it’s gotten drastically worse? And that it’s just, it’s a show pony exercise. Now the theatrical release, you know, and then, like, yeah, in two weeks, you can watch it on this [streamer] and that one. Okay. Theater? You can’t do that. It’s the final frontier.”
It Could Be Some Time Before His Next Movie
Tarantino’s comments come from a place of frustration, from a man who was first and foremost a movie fan before he was a filmmaker. His comments suggest that he is jaded with the direction the industry has taken, as well as the rise in the prominence (and dominance) of streaming services over long theatrical runs. It is worth noting, that this is not the first time Tarantino has taken aim at the industry, with the director famously criticizing Marvel movies as being formulaic, and suggesting they have contributed to the death of the classic movie star.
While the industry is struggling, there is more of a need than ever for talented and creative minds, and Tarantino’s 10th movie could be the perfect tonic to help boost box office takings and improve audience engagement in theaters.
Judging by what he has to say above, it seems Tarantino believes things have only gotten worse. The outspoken Oscar winner also recently proclaimed television as an inferior medium to movies, but it seems as though he believes there needs to be massive changes made across the industry, and he has little interest in returning to make his 10th and final film any time soon. This is likely one of the reasons that has inspired him to pivot creatively and write a play, while leaving his final movie project on the backburner.
The Director Does Have A Point, But His 10th Film Could Help Get Things Back On Track
Tarantino does have a point about the direction the movie industry is going in, though as a perfectionist, he is perhaps more critical than most audiences would be. Furthermore, while the industry is struggling, there is more of a need than ever for talented and creative minds, and Tarantino’s 10th movie could be the perfect tonic to help boost box office takings and improve audience engagement in theaters. Much will come down to how his play pans out, and Tarantino could be back behind the camera sooner rather than later.
There Have Been Great Movies Since Once Upon A Time…In Hollywood Was Released
While there is definitely merit to Tarantino’s criticisms, his comments also oversimplify the issues at hand. Increasingly shortened theatrical releases, the proliferation of streaming services, studios’ relying on already popular intellectual properties, and diminishing returns for those who work on movies are among the many problems that are currently plaguing the industry. That being said, it is an oversimplification to say that 2019 “was the last f*cking year of movies.”

Tarantino referencing 2019 is no accident, as it is the year he released his latest film, Once Upon a Time…in Hollywood, and the last year before the industry was upended by the Covid-19 pandemic. Since Tarantino’s last release and despite the challenges that came with the pandemic, there have been many phenomenal movies that have debuted and that have found critical and commercial success. Oppenheimer, Everything Everywhere All at Once, and Dune: Part Two are only a few of the best movies to be released so far in the 2020s.

ES9032 leakage switch tester, also known as leakage switch tester, Residual-current device tester, residual current operated protector tester, residual current operated protector tester, is a necessary testing instrument for engineering quality supervision stations and construction companies, which can measure the action time and action current of leakage switches.
It is mainly used to test the leakage action current, leakage inaction current and leakage action time of Residual-current device.
It can be widely used in power supply departments, agricultural power departments, Residual-current device manufacturers, labor security inspection departments in construction, mining, machine tools and other industries, as well as electricians.
The ES9032 Leakage Switch Tester consists of a host, a testing line, etc. Simple and portable, with a 4-digit large LCD display and a gray and white screen display, it is clear at a glance and easy to operate and use. Large capacity storage of 500 sets of data, AC voltage measurement range: 0V~750V, DC voltage measurement range: 0V~1000V, measurement accuracy: ± 5% rdg ± 5dgt.
The test leakage current ranges from 15 to 500mA, divided into ten gears (15; 30; 50; 75; 100; 150; 200; 250; 300; 500mA), and the test leakage current action time range is 0 to 999mS.

ATLANTA — After widespread wintry precipitation fell across metro Atlanta Tuesday, the concern now turns to moisture freezing onto roads and bridges.
11Alive is monitoring current road conditions below, where you can keep track of real-time traffic data and road temperatures.
While the Georgia Department of Transportation has been treating interstate and major state roadways since Sunday in advance of the winter weather, numerous crashes and incidents were reported on Georgia’s interstates and state routes since snow fell.
Drivers have warned to stay off the roads until further notice.
